Understanding the Problem

First off, let's talk about why waste sand is a problem. When you use a Laser Glass Sandblasting Machine or an Automatic Glass Sandblasting Machine, the sand gets contaminated with glass particles, dust, and other debris during the sandblasting process. This contaminated sand can't be reused directly, and if not handled properly, it can cause environmental problems and increase costs.

Recycling the Waste Sand

One of the best ways to deal with waste sand is to recycle it. Recycling not only reduces waste but also saves money on new sand purchases. Here's how you can do it:

1. Separation

The first step in recycling waste sand is to separate the contaminants from the sand. You can use a series of screens and filters to remove larger glass particles and debris. There are also magnetic separators available that can remove any ferrous metals that might be present in the waste sand.

2. Cleaning

After separation, the sand needs to be cleaned to remove the remaining dust and small glass particles. You can use a sand washer or a similar device to clean the sand. This usually involves agitating the sand in water to loosen the contaminants and then filtering the water to remove the dirt.

3. Reuse

Once the sand is clean, it can be reused in the sandblasting process. However, you need to make sure that the recycled sand meets the quality requirements for your specific application. In some cases, you might need to mix the recycled sand with new sand to achieve the desired results.

Selling the Waste Sand

If recycling the waste sand isn't an option for you, another alternative is to sell it. There are companies that specialize in buying waste sand and reprocessing it for other uses. For example, the waste sand can be used in construction projects, such as making concrete or asphalt. You can search online or contact local recycling companies to find potential buyers for your waste sand.

Proper Disposal

If recycling or selling the waste sand isn't feasible, you'll need to dispose of it properly. Improper disposal of waste sand can lead to environmental pollution and legal issues. Here are some guidelines for proper disposal:

1. Check Local Regulations

Before disposing of the waste sand, make sure you check the local regulations regarding waste disposal. Different areas have different rules and requirements, so it's important to comply with them to avoid any fines or penalties.

2. Use a Licensed Waste Disposal Company

To ensure that the waste sand is disposed of properly, it's recommended to use a licensed waste disposal company. These companies have the expertise and equipment to handle and dispose of the waste sand in an environmentally friendly manner.

3. Landfill Disposal

If landfill disposal is the only option, make sure the waste sand is placed in a designated landfill site. Some landfills have specific requirements for the disposal of industrial waste, so you'll need to follow their guidelines.

Tips for Reducing Waste Sand Generation

In addition to dealing with the waste sand, it's also a good idea to take steps to reduce the amount of waste sand generated in the first place. Here are some tips:

1. Optimize the Sandblasting Process

Make sure you're using the right type and amount of sand for your sandblasting job. Using too much sand can lead to more waste, while using the wrong type of sand can result in inefficient sandblasting and more frequent sand changes.

2. Maintain the Sandblasting Machine

Regular maintenance of your glass sandblasting machine can help ensure that it's operating efficiently. This includes cleaning the machine regularly, checking the hoses and nozzles for wear and tear, and replacing any damaged parts.

3. Train Your Operators

Proper training of your operators can also help reduce waste sand generation. Make sure your operators know how to use the sandblasting machine correctly, including how to adjust the pressure and flow rate of the sand.
